Jason -- most of those from small drills are threaded for 3/8 by 24, and some have a place for a locking screw that threads into the fitting.
If you look on the body (often near the bottom or on the bottom, most have markings for what the mating threads or taper is. JT3 and JT33 are common, and the adapting arbors are readily available from a number of sources (Enco, Little Machine Shop, JohnnyCNC and others).
My little metal lathe has a 3/4 by 16 thread and I have a number of drill chucks threaded for that.
